Director Anthony Methvin avoids re-creating the better-known film version of the story

The biggest challenge of staging a play later made into a very successful film is that when the story ultimately makes its way back to the theater, audiences have built-in ideas about who should play the roles and how.

Methvin, Backyard’s cofounder and producing director, has cast six women actors who aren’t attempting to re-create the film’s unforgettable performances. Instead these actors have made the roles their own, and that’s a good thing. The film sometimes tipped into melodrama, scenery-chewing and dramatic eye rolls, but Methvin’s Backyard production aims for more authenticity and understatement.

Marci Anne Wuebben as M’Lynn and Liliana Talwatte as Shelby in Backyard Renaissance Theatre’s “Steel Magnolias.”Wendy Maples anchors the play with a warm and gentle performance as hairstylist Truvy, whose 1980s-era back-bedroom salon has been nicely designed and well-appointed by Tony Cucuzzella. The play opens on Shelby’s wedding day, when she and her mother, M’Lynn, have arrived at Truvy’s for hairdos.

And speaking of laughs, despite the play’s sad moments, it’s very funny, with so many great lines that several online articles can be found listing the script’s best one-liners. My favorite is Shelby’s declaration about pregnancy to her mother that she’d “rather have 30 minutes of wonderful than a lifetime of nothing special.”
